Copper Soaking Tubs
Copper soaking tubs add luxury and warmth to cabin bathrooms, perfectly complementing rustic aesthetics.
Imagine sinking into a tub that gleams like a cozy campfire, inviting relaxation after a day of hiking. These tubs aren’t only visually appealing but also functional, as copper naturally retains heat, keeping your soak warm longer on chilly evenings.
Cleaning is easy—just soap and water are needed. Over time, a unique patina develops, making each tub a one-of-a-kind piece of art.
Despite their appearance, copper tubs are lightweight and easy to install. You can find styles to match your cabin’s vibe, whether modern or traditional.

Stone Bathtubs
Enhance your cabin bathroom’s spa-like ambiance with a stone bathtub as a stunning centerpiece.
Imagine sinking into its smooth, natural surface after a long hike—pure bliss! Available in various shapes and sizes, these bathtubs fit seamlessly into rustic cabin settings with their earthy tones and textures.
Initially cool to the touch, they warm up as you soak, providing durability without worries of chipping or cracking.

Industrial Chic Bathtubs
Transform your cabin bathroom into a stylish retreat with an industrial chic aesthetic by blending raw materials and sleek designs for a warm, edgy vibe.
Consider these key elements when selecting an industrial chic bathtub:
- Material: Choose bathtubs made of cast iron, concrete, or steel for rugged charm and durability.
- Design: Opt for clean, geometric shapes for a modern yet cozy feel.
- Exposed Features: Display pipes or brackets to enhance the industrial look.
- Colors: Use darker or metallic finishes for striking contrast against lighter walls.
